We Asked the Same Category Two Ways. The Buying Question Cited Eight Sources, the Definition Cited None

Same category, same market, same day. Asked which platform to buy, ChatGPT cited eight domains. Asked what the thing is, it cited zero.

· Updated · 24 min read

On 8 August 2026 we put two questions about email marketing to ChatGPT and Gemini, minutes apart, in the same market and the same language. “What is the best email marketing platform for ecommerce?” came back with eight cited domains from ChatGPT and five from Gemini. “What is email marketing automation?” came back with zero from both. Same category. Same day. Same two surfaces. The only thing that changed was whether the question asked what to buy or what a word means.

That is the finding, and it has a blunt consequence: the “what is X” explainer, the single most recommended format in every generative engine optimization guide including several we have reviewed, is a format that two of the four surfaces we measure will often refuse to cite anyone for.

How this was measured: Six definitional questions and one buying question, run through the real interfaces of ChatGPT, Gemini, Google AI Overview and Google AI Mode on 8 August 2026 with country and language set explicitly on every call, using our own measurement tooling. We count cited domains only, never the results a surface searched and then ignored, because conflating those two is an error we have made in public before and corrected. Every run below is in our measurement register with its date and its surface count. The rows are in our measurement register, each with its surfaces and its run count.

Updated the same day with repeated, uncached runs. This article first published with one run per surface per question, and the fair criticism of that is that a single run is a draw and not a rate. We have since repeated the controlled pair on a path that bypasses caching. The finding held. The section on repetition below gives the numbers and, more usefully, explains why the obvious way of repeating a measurement in this category produces a fake denominator. The pair has since also been replicated in two unrelated categories, CRM and project management.


The short version

  1. The controlled pair is the whole study. Same category, same market, same day, same two surfaces: buying question, ChatGPT 8 domains and Gemini 5. Definitional question, both zero.
  2. Across six definitional questions in four languages, ChatGPT cited sources in exactly one. Across nine buying questions, it cited sources in all nine.
  3. Google’s two surfaces cite either way. AI Overview and AI Mode returned sources for every question of both kinds. The split is a chat assistant behaviour, not an AI search behaviour.
  4. The one exception is instructive and we could not reproduce it. The German question about LLMO is the only definitional question where ChatGPT cited anything, and the only one where it ran a search at all.
  5. It replicates in categories we have nothing to do with. Nine uncached runs across definitional questions in email marketing, CRM and project management returned zero cited sources. The buying question in each of the same three categories cited twelve to fifteen domains.
  6. It survived repetition, and the obvious way to repeat it is broken. Three uncached runs per chat surface kept the definitional zero. Repeating through a normal cached request returns byte-identical text even for a reworded question, so “ten runs” that way is one observation with a costume on.
  7. And ten days later the one citable definition stopped being citable. Re-run on 18 August 2026, the German LLMO question went from 3 cited domains and a recorded search to 0 and no search at all, while the buying question run minutes later cited 4 domains and recorded 4 fan-out queries.
  8. This corrects one of our own articles. Our German LLMO piece concluded the definition layer was the more stable place to compete. The measurement it rested on only sampled the two surfaces that always cite. Corrected below.

The controlled pair

Everything else here is breadth. This is the part that is actually controlled.

Question, US English, 8 August 2026ChatGPTGemini
what is the best email marketing platform for ecommerce?85
What is email marketing automation?00

Both questions are about email marketing. Both were asked in the United States in English. Both ran on the same day through the same two surfaces. One asks which product to choose and one asks what a term means.

On the buying question ChatGPT cited emailtooltester.com, a Contentful-hosted BigCommerce guide, and the homepages of Klaviyo, Omnisend, ActiveCampaign, Mailchimp, Shopify and Brevo. It also searched eleven further domains it did not cite, which is why we publish citations and not search lists. Gemini cited klaviyo.com, maropost.com, emailtooltester.com, insiderone.com and emailvendorselection.com. Two domains, emailtooltester.com and klaviyo.com, were cited by both.

On the definitional question, both surfaces produced long, competent, well-structured answers. ChatGPT’s ran to roughly five hundred words with a worked example, a diagram of a welcome sequence and a list of six named platforms. Gemini’s had headings, a three-part breakdown of triggers, workflows and content, and four worked examples. Neither cited a single source.

The answers were not worse. They were unattributable. There was no bibliography for any publisher to be in.

The same split across four languages

We ran the definitional form in four languages to see whether the pair above was a fluke of one topic.

Definitional questionMarketChatGPTGeminiAI OverviewAI Mode
What is generative engine optimization?US, English04810
What is generative engine optimization and how does it differ from SEO?US, English05not runnot run
What is email marketing automation?US, English00823
¿Qué es la optimización para motores generativos (GEO)?Spain, Spanish00910
Qu’est-ce que l’optimisation pour les moteurs génératifs (GEO) ?France, French00814
Was ist LLMO und wie unterscheidet es sich von GEO?Germany, German371211

Read the ChatGPT column down. Five zeros and a three.

Now read the same column for the buying questions we have measured, all of them already published and registered: eleven for running shoes, sixteen for email platforms, four for the American GEO agency question, one for the French, three for the German, one for the second German wording, one for the Spanish, six for the American AI visibility tool question, and eight for the email platform question above. Nine buying questions, nine non-zero counts, ranging from one to sixteen.

Six definitional questions, one non-zero count.

One caveat we added the same day, because it cuts against the tidy version of this. A tenth buying question, “what is the best accounting software for freelancers?”, was measured uncached on ChatGPT after the above. Its first run cited nothing at all, and a second call of two runs cited twelve domains with every one appearing in exactly one of the two. So a buying question can return zero, and the same buying question can swing from zero to twelve between runs. The sentence above says nine buying questions gave nine non-zero counts, which is true of those nine and should not be read as “buying questions cite”.

The asymmetry survives that, and is worth restating precisely rather than conveniently. On the definitional side the zero held across nine uncached runs in three unrelated categories, with no run producing a single citation. On the buying side the count ranges from zero to sixteen, sometimes on the same question. Never citing and sometimes not citing are different claims, and only the first is ours.

Gemini splits the same way but less sharply: it cited on eight of nine buying questions and on three of six definitional ones.

The two Google surfaces do not split at all. AI Overview and AI Mode returned cited sources on every question of both kinds they answered, with one exception that is not a silence: on the American AI visibility tool question, AI Overview returned an upstream error instead of an answer, and that row is registered as three surfaces rather than counted as a zero. Everywhere else, both cited. If your definitional page is going to be cited anywhere, that is where.

We repeated it, because one run is a fair criticism

The most common objection to work like this, and the correct one, is that a single run per surface is a draw rather than a rate. Anyone can get a zero once. So we repeated the controlled pair. Getting that right turned out to be more interesting than the result.

The obvious method is void. We first re-ran “What is email marketing automation?” five times in a row. All five came back with zero citations, which looks like confirmation until you read the text: all five were identical, byte for byte, on both ChatGPT and Gemini. Then we changed the string. “What is email marketing automation” without the question mark returned the same text again. “Can you explain what email marketing automation is?”, which is a differently worded question, returned the same text a seventh time, down to the same hand-drawn ASCII diagram of a welcome sequence.

Three different inputs, one identical output. That is a cache, and it is not keyed on the exact string, because the three strings differ. Publishing “zero citations in ten runs” off the back of that would have been a fabricated denominator: it is one observation served seven times.

So we re-ran the pair on a path that bypasses the cache and re-plans retrieval on every request. That is the measurement below.

Question, US English, 8 August 2026SurfaceUncached runsDistinct domains cited
What is email marketing automation?ChatGPT30
What is email marketing automation?Gemini30
what is the best email marketing platform for ecommerce?ChatGPT215
what is the best email marketing platform for ecommerce?Gemini39

The definitional zero survives repetition. Three uncached runs on each chat surface, no citations in any of them.

The buying side produced the more surprising number. Across the two uncached ChatGPT runs, fifteen distinct domains were cited and every one of them appeared in exactly one of the two runs. The two runs shared no cited domain at all. Gemini was steadier but not steady: of nine domains, three appeared in all three runs (drip.com, maropost.com and emailtooltester.com) and six appeared in only one.

That asymmetry is the practical lesson, and it cuts against our own first draft as much as anyone’s. On a definitional question a single run is adequate, because zero has no variance and repeating it tells you nothing new. On a buying question a single run is close to worthless, because the citation set is substantially reshuffled between runs. Any vendor reporting your “AI visibility” for a commercial query off one daily run is reporting a coin flip, and any vendor repeating a query through a cache is drawing you a flat line by construction. Both are worth asking about before you buy.

Three categories, three pairs, nine uncached runs, no citations

The second fair objection, after the one about run counts, is that all of this is about generative engine optimization and email marketing, and we sell generative engine optimization. A finding that only shows up in your own industry is a finding about your own industry.

So we ran the same controlled pair in two categories we have nothing to do with, uncached, on ChatGPT.

CategoryDefinitional questionDomainsBuying questionDomains
Email marketingWhat is email marketing automation?0 in 3 runsbest email marketing platform for ecommerce?15 in 2 runs
CRMWhat is a CRM?0 in 3 runsbest CRM for a small business?12 in 1 run
Project managementWhat is project management software?0 in 3 runsbest project management software for a remote team?13 in 1 run

Nine uncached runs across three definitional questions in three unrelated categories, and not one cited source. Three buying questions in the same three categories, all cited, twelve to fifteen domains each.

The run counts are uneven and it is worth being explicit about which way that cuts. The definitional half has three uncached runs each because a zero is only worth anything if you repeated it. The buying half has one or two because ChatGPT is slow enough that the tool stopped early, and because that half only has to establish that citations happen at all, which one run returning thirteen domains does comfortably. If the asymmetry favoured our claim we would not publish it. It runs the other way: the half we repeated hardest is the half that returned nothing.

One detail from the buying runs is worth more than the counts. On the CRM question, three of the twelve cited domains are trade media you would expect, technologyadvice.com, forbes.com and techradar.com. The other nine include konabayev.com, softabase.com, themona.global, b2bbrief.com and americanbusinesscenter.org, which are not names anyone in the CRM market would recognise. On the project management question, six of the thirteen are the vendors themselves, monday.com, asana.com and clickup.com plus three of their support subdomains.

So the buying layer is reachable, and reachable by small sites. That is exactly what makes the definitional result worth acting on: it is not that citations are hard to win, it is that on these questions there are none to win.

The exception we could not explain away

The German LLMO question is the only definitional question where ChatGPT cited anything, and the obvious explanation is wrong.

Our first guess was the phrasing. That question asks for a comparison, “what is LLMO and how does it differ from GEO”, rather than a plain “what is X”, and a comparison plausibly needs reconciling two sources. So we tested it: we asked “What is generative engine optimization and how does it differ from SEO?” in the United States in English, same day, same two surfaces.

ChatGPT cited zero. The comparative form changed nothing. Gemini went from four cited domains to five, which is noise at this sample size.

So the comparative structure is not what did it. What is visible in the German run and absent from every English one is that ChatGPT actually searched. Its own fan-out query is recorded: “LLMO definition GEO generative engine optimization difference”. It searched nine domains and cited three of them, and its answer says out loud that the two terms are used “teilweise synonym”, partially synonymously. On the English questions there is no fan-out query and no search at all.

The reading that fits is that the assistant searches when it treats a term as unsettled and answers from its weights when it treats the term as settled. LLMO is a recent label with genuine disagreement about whether it differs from GEO. Email marketing automation is not in dispute. Generative engine optimization, in English, has a Wikipedia article and apparently counts as settled.

That is one observation and we are labelling it as one. It is a hypothesis with a visible mechanism, not a result. What we can say without hedging is the negative: the comparative phrasing did not reproduce the effect, so anyone planning to win ChatGPT citations by rewriting “what is X” as “what is X and how does it differ from Y” should measure that themselves before believing it.

Ten days later, the term we were watching stopped being citable

When this published we said the prompts were frozen and would be re-run, and we named the number to watch: whether the English GEO definition starts triggering a search again, or whether the German one stops.

On 18 August 2026 we re-ran them. The German one stopped.

Was ist LLMO und wie unterscheidet es sich von GEO?8 August18 August
ChatGPT, cited domains30
ChatGPT, search performedyesno
Gemini, cited domains74

On 8 August this was the only definitional question of the six where ChatGPT cited anything, and the only one where a fan-out query was recorded. Ten days later there is no fan-out query and no citation. The answer is still competent, still says the two terms are used “teilweise synonym”, and is now produced without looking anything up.

The control is what makes that readable. A definitional zero means nothing on a day when the tool is not retrieving at all, so we ran the buying question the same day, minutes apart: 4 cited domains and 4 fan-out queries recorded, against 45 search results. Retrieval was working. It just was not used on the definition.

That is the direction this article predicted, and it is worth being exact about what it is and is not. It is two points in time, not a series. It is one run per cell, and the re-read came back byte-identical, which is the cache this article already documents rather than a second observation. And an observed direction is not a demonstrated cause: nothing here shows that the term settling is what closed the window, only that the window closed in the ten days after we said to watch it.

The English GEO definition, the other half of the pair we named, timed out twice on the chat surface and is not measured here. It was zero on 8 August, so the interesting half was never it.

What it costs a plan, if it holds. The window to be cited for defining a category is not open indefinitely and may be measured in weeks. LLMO was a term young enough on 8 August that the assistant went and looked; ten days of the web writing about it was apparently enough for it to stop. Anyone planning to own a definition should assume the citable phase is the early one.

What this costs a content plan

Every guide to this discipline, ours included, tells you to write the self-contained definitional paragraph. That advice is not wrong, and the Princeton GEO-bench experiment over ten thousand queries is still the best evidence for the format: adding quotations raised a source’s share of the answer by 41%, statistics by 30% and cited sources by 27%, while keyword stuffing scored below doing nothing.

But format advice only pays where there is a bibliography. On five of the six definitional questions above, ChatGPT produced no bibliography for anyone. The most citable definitional paragraph ever written would have been cited zero times in those answers, because no page was.

So the honest version of the advice has a condition attached:

  • A definitional page is a bet on Google’s AI surfaces, not on the chat assistants. AI Overview and AI Mode cited on every definitional question we ran, between 8 and 23 domains each time. That is a real and winnable surface.
  • On a settled term, the chat assistants are answering from training, not retrieval. Nothing you publish this quarter reaches an answer that never performs a search. The lever there is being in the next training corpus and being described consistently everywhere, which is a twelve-month move, not a content-calendar move.
  • The buying question is where retrieval happens. Nine of nine. If you want a citation this month from a chat assistant, the page has to answer a question that has a purchase at the end of it.
  • Measure the question, not the topic. Two questions about email marketing, one day apart in the same market, produced thirteen citation slots and zero citation slots. Anyone reporting “AI visibility for email marketing” as a single number is averaging across that gap.

The correction to our own article

On 8 August 2026 we published a German piece on LLMO which concluded that definitional questions produce far more agreement between surfaces than buying questions, and that the definition layer is therefore the more stable place for a brand to compete. It reported seventeen cited domains with six of them appearing on both surfaces measured, more than a third, against near-zero agreement on the buying questions.

The arithmetic was right and the comparison was not sound, for a reason we flagged in that article as a limitation and then reasoned past anyway. That run measured two surfaces, AI Overview and AI Mode. The buying runs it was compared against measured four. Those two Google surfaces are precisely the two that cite on every question, so restricting to them selects for agreement. We compared a two-Google-surface measurement against four-surface measurements and read the difference as a property of the question.

With four more definitional questions measured, agreement between those same two Google surfaces runs like this: 29% for the English GEO definition, 19% for the Spanish, 11% for the email automation definition, 10% for the French, and the German 35%. The German figure is the top of the range, not a typical value.

The German article has been corrected to say this. Its practical advice about writing an extractable paragraph stands, because that rests on the Princeton work and on which pages the Google surfaces actually cite. Its claim that the definition layer is the more stable place to compete does not stand, and the replacement finding is the one in this article: on definitional questions the chat assistants often cite nobody, which is a harder problem than low agreement.

We also closed the gap that article declared. It said ChatGPT and Gemini were never asked its question because the four-surface call timed out. They have now been asked, on the same day, and the answer is three cited domains and seven.

What we did not measure

  • Repetition beyond the controlled pair. The pair was repeated on the uncached path, three runs per chat surface. The other five definitional questions and the four-surface rows are still one run each, and the register records the run count on every row for exactly this reason. Where a row says one run, it means one.
  • Perplexity and Claude. Our measurement reads ChatGPT, Gemini, Google AI Overview and Google AI Mode through their real interfaces. Those two are not in the set and we claim nothing about them.
  • Whether the uncited answers were correct. We counted who gets cited, not whether what they say is true. The uncited definitional answers looked accurate to us, which is part of what makes them hard to compete with.
  • Whether this holds as terms age. The mechanism we think we saw predicts that a term becomes uncitable as it settles. That is a claim about change over time and we have one day of data, so it is a question for a repeat run against the same frozen prompts, not a conclusion.
  • Logged-in or personalised behaviour. These are clean sessions. A user with history may get different retrieval decisions.

Common Questions About Uncited Definitions

Does ChatGPT ever cite sources for a “what is” question?

Yes, but rarely in our measurement. Across six definitional questions in four languages on 8 August 2026 it cited sources in one, the German question about LLMO, where three domains were cited. In the other five it produced complete answers with no sources at all. Across nine buying questions measured on 7 and 8 August 2026 it cited sources in all nine. A tenth, measured later the same day, cited nothing on its first uncached run and twelve domains across two more, so buying questions are not guaranteed to cite either. What separates them is that the definitional zero held in every one of nine uncached runs, while the buying count ranges from zero to sixteen.

Why would an AI answer a definition without citing anything?

Because it does not search. In the runs where ChatGPT cited nothing there is no fan-out query recorded, meaning no retrieval was performed and the answer came from the model’s training. In the one German run where it did cite, a search query is recorded. A model that considers a term settled has no reason to look it up.

Does this mean definitional content is worthless for AI visibility?

No, it means the surface matters. Google AI Overview and Google AI Mode cited sources on every definitional question we ran, between 8 and 23 domains each. A definitional page is a bet on those surfaces. What it is not is a reliable way to be cited by a chat assistant on a term the model treats as settled.

How many runs is this based on?

The controlled pair was repeated three times per chat surface on a cache-bypassing path, and the definitional zero held in every run. The other five definitional questions and the four-surface rows are one run each, and the register records the count on every row. A warning for anyone repeating this: re-asking the same question through a normal cached request returns identical text, so ten such “runs” are one observation, not ten. We hit that and say so above rather than publishing the inflated denominator it would have produced.

Is this only true in your own industry?

No. The controlled pair was repeated in CRM and project management, categories we have no involvement in. “What is a CRM?” and “What is project management software?” each returned zero cited domains across three uncached ChatGPT runs, while “what is the best CRM for a small business?” and “what is the best project management software for a remote team?” cited twelve and thirteen domains. Nine uncached definitional runs across three unrelated categories, no citations in any of them.

Does repeating the question change the answer?

It depends entirely on the question type, which is the useful part. On the definitional question, three uncached runs per surface produced zero citations every time. On the buying question, two uncached ChatGPT runs cited fifteen domains between them and shared none: every domain appeared in exactly one of the two runs. Gemini cited nine across three runs, of which three appeared every time. So a single run is adequate for a definitional question and close to meaningless for a commercial one.
